Sonoran Smoked Brisket
Prep Time: 15 Minutes
Cook Time: 9 Hours
Serves: 12 people
Ingredients
Rub
SPICE & EZ --- Sonoran Salt Rubmain
- 1 1/2 (12-14 lb) whole packer brisket, trimmed
- 2 1/4 Cup beef broth
Steps
- When ready to cook, set smoker temperature to 225℉ and preheat, lid closed for 15 minutes.
- For the Rub: Sonoran Salt Rub
- Season the brisket on all sides with the rub.
- Place brisket, fat side down on grill grate. Cook brisket until it reaches an internal temperature of 160℉, about 5 to 6 hours. When brisket reaches internal temperature of 160℉, remove from grill.
- Double wrap meat in aluminum foil and add the beef broth to the foil packet. Return brisket to grill and cook until it reaches an internal temperature of 204℉, about 3 hours more.
- Once finished, remove from grill, unwrap from foil and let rest for 15 minutes. Slice against the grain and serve.
